FPGA_WAV_Player
一个简单的项目,使您可以在FPGA甚至CPLD上播放WAV文件。作为信息的载体,使用了25系列的SPI闪光灯,其中PCM,8位,U8,单声道,单声道格式文件被记录(可以在线使用转换器进行转换)。采样频率是该文件适合闪存驱动器上的任何。为了配置项目中所需的频率,有一个参数“ wav_freq”。
该项目不使用任何特定的模块(例如PLL,BRAM等),因此您可以轻松地将PracterGecks转移到具有足够量的LUT的任何FPGA,CPLD中。例如,针对FPGA旋风IV的Quartus II中编译的项目占175个细胞。
该项目本身由频度计(采样),一个由分隔仪表进行的存储器仪表,最终自动机器和最终机器,该机器控制SPI Automaton,Shim(8位)仪表,该仪(8位)米,而不是DAC来衍生声音。所有这些都位于一个模块内。项目文本中有很多评论,因此很难弄清楚。
